ALLIED DIGITAL SERVICES BUYS 80% IN ENPOINTE GLOBAL SERVICES FOR $24M: CITY-BASED systems integrator Allied Digital Services has acquired 80.5% stake in EnPointe Global Services, a subsidiary of the Nasdaq-listed Enpointe Technologies, for $24 million in a cashand-stock deal. The deal values the EnPointe Global at $30 million......More....
